Moreover, how do I make text transparent in PicMonkey?

  1. Open a blank canvas in the dimensions you desire.
  2. In the Background Tools menu on the left tab column, click Background color.
  3. Click the Transparent checkbox underneath the color continuum.
  4. Add your text to the canvas and adjust as desired.

How do you add text on PicMonkey?

  1. Open an image or template in PicMonkey.
  2. Click the Text tab (the β€œTt” icon on the far left).
  3. Click Add text at the top of the panel.
  4. Click inside the text box and type your text.

How do I make text have no background?

  1. Right-click the text box that you want to make invisible.
  2. On the shortcut menu, click Format Text Box.
  3. On the Colors and Lines tab, in the Fill section, click the arrow next to Color, and then click No Color.
  4. On the Colors and Lines tab, in the Line section, click the arrow next to Color, and then click No Color.
